Resumen:
We review different attempts to show the decoherence process in double-slitlikeexperiments both for charged particles (electrons) and for neutral particleswith permanent dipole moments. Interference is studied when electrons oratomic systems are coupled to classical or quantum electromagnetic fields.The interaction between the particles and time dependent fields induces a time varying Aharonov phase. Averaging over the phase generates a suppression of fringe visibility in the interference pattern. We show that, for suitable  experimental conditions, the loss of contrast for dipoles can be almost as largeas the corresponding one for coherent electrons and therefore be observed.We analyse different trajectories in order to show the dependence of the decoherence factor on the velocity of the particles.
